## Relevance Tuning — Onboarding Notes (Weekly Eng Sync)

The Quellbird search stack weights title matches at 2.4x and body matches at 1.0x, with a freshness decay applied after 90 days. Before adjusting boosts, replay the saved query set from the Marlowe benchmark suite and compare NDCG deltas against last week's baseline. Any change over 0.02 needs sign-off from the relevance rotation. To run the replay harness locally, your env file must authenticate against the scoring service, so add the following line:

env line for fafof-fahag: LEDGER_TOKEN5=f8790

## Break-Glass Access: Tracewire Request Tracing

If the Tracewire span collector fails across the Lumenpath microservices mesh, break-glass access restores trace ingestion by bypassing the auth relay. Use this only when on-call escalation has been exhausted. The emergency console at the Velstra admin tier accepts a recovery passphrase in place of federated login. Enter it exactly as shown below.

strongbox words: fenwyn-lamix-novael-holeth-sorix-druael-lamwyn

# Break-Glass: Catalog Cache Invalidation

Scope: the Pinrow product catalog at Veldstone Retail. If stale prices persist after a purge and the Hollowmere invalidation queue is wedged, use break-glass to flush the edge tier directly. Contractors: get verbal sign-off from the catalog lead first. Steps: open the Hollowmere admin shell, select emergency-flush, confirm the tenant, and run it once — repeated flushes thrash the origin. Access is logged and expires after 20 minutes. Unseal the admin shell with the passphrase below.

recovery phrase for kahop-tajog: istix-casvan

MEETING NOTES — Depot uniforms, 3rd session

Attendees: ops leads, procurement. Decision: new Halwick Road depot staff and contracted couriers get charcoal Merrow & Sons uniforms with orange trim. Old tan kit retired end of month. Office manager to order 40 sets and post sizing sheet by Friday. Couriers in old kit will be turned away after cutover. The confidential courier hand-over instruction follows below.

courier memo of fahag-badug: the norys istion courier leaves the zoriel ledger at gate 4000 under passcode 457370